e c l i p s e d | Ambient/Experimental/Glitch/Drone | 75:32 A tribute to, & distillation of, the 2024 various artists ‘Somber‘ release (March 29th) on Sounds for the Soul records. Constructed between 4.11 & 4.13.2024, the week of the solar eclipse. All tracks taken from “Somber” except track one, which was taken from “Forgotten Stories” by Daou. This is a bit dark & edgy — I tried to imagine what it would be like on the edge of the sun’s surface during the eclipse, interspersing moments of darkness & light. 5 Characteristics of Ambient Music
Ambient Landscape
by gabulmer
2w ago
Emphasis on atmosphere and texture: From the new age-adjacent ambient style of Brian Eno to the psychedelic sounds of ambient dub music, the genre seeks to build atmosphere above all else.  Gradual exploration of timbre: Ambient music lingers on notes and chords for a long period of time. Artists create variation by shifting the timbre of the sounds, either by introducing new instruments or by applying filters to electronic sounds. Minimal harmonic progression: Ambient music does not cycle through chords the way that pop music, jazz, and classical music do. It luxuriates on simple chords o ..read more

The Sleeper Wakes, by Marc Barreca
Ambient Landscape
by gabulmer
1M ago
Marc Barreca’s 1986 album “The Sleeper Wakes”. Originally released on cassette by the Seattle electronic ambient label, Intrepid. Very subtle and quiet music by a sound artist and synth-head Marc Barreca. He is usually associated with K. Leimer’s Palace Of Light imprint and Seattle’s small, but very distinctive experimental and ambient music scene of the late 1970s and 80s. Barreca has a small, but very strong and surprisingly (for ambient music anyway) varied back-catalogue, which in the last couple of years has been revisited by a number of reissue labels.
